This is a turn-based tactical game developed by the studio FTL: Faster Than Lightis a fantastically cryptic roguelike that encourages out-of-the-box thinking. In the breach has a simple mission-based structure where players lead a squad of mechs against alien bugs while protecting civilians on small grids.

Thanks to the small scale of each level, each player's move can be monumental, and the stakes are almost always high. This ensures that every strategic success or failure often has a long-lasting effect on the turn. Fortunately, players can undo actions and even reset their entire turn, keeping the experience from being frustrating. Although players can change their strategy from turn to turn, In the breach allows for multiple playstyles with plenty of alternate mech squads, each unlockable over time.

Darkest DungeonThe gritty painted art style and dark gothic setting may get people through the door, but its brutal turn-based combat and the variety of playstyles it facilitates are perhaps its greatest strengths. From the ebb and flow of its dungeon-crawling structure and variety of classes to the city management aspects of the game, Darkest Dungeon it's a diverse experience.
Each class of Art Darkest Dungeon play dramatically differently, and their abilities vary depending on where they are in the four-man squad. This, combined with a large number of items and upgrades, allows you to create different styles. However, each player's style can sometimes be limited by the fact that some classes flatly refuse to work with each other.

This auto-butler may feature minimalist visuals, but its gameplay, while easy to pick up, allows for a huge variety of styles. Super Auto Pets tasks players with creating a squad of five pets, each with their own unique characteristics and abilities, and the variety of potential pets creates many possible strategies.
The interactions and synergies between each of these pets provide an effective engine that drives much of the gameplay. However, the freedom may be somewhat limited by the luck of the draw as the game has many random elements Super Auto Petsoften forcing players to adapt their strategy on the fly.

Like a deck builder, Slay The Spire inherently offers many options. However, unlike other deck builders, Slay The Spire giving players constant opportunities to add cards to their deck. Additionally, the unique map scan structure allows players to choose the right path for their current state and strategy.

Slay The Spire also contains several playable characters. Each of these characters is extremely unique, with their own distinctive set of available cards that themselves offer their own synergies and strategies to unlock. Combined with plenty of relics and unique game-changing cards, Slay The Spire can offer a very diverse network of strategies.

Frost is a unique deck builder not only because of its companion gameplay that combines elements of Hearth with a traditional card game, but also for its structure. Between each battle, players are given a choice of two unique paths. Each of these paths brings its own set of rewards, all at the same time, offering players a serious power surge that's refreshingly fast-paced. By giving players access to their rewards in short bursts, it becomes easier to strategize as more knowledge is available at once.
The cards and their variety of types, including spells to cast and companions to summon, also offer variety. Additionally, the game has a variety of amulets that can change the way a companion plays. This is the icing on the cake Frost also features multiple factions, each playing differently, which is evident from the start of each run thanks to unique starting decks.

of course Starcraft 2 obeys the meta and, as a result, optimal strategies that force players to be effective. However, the asymmetric factions are extremely unique, and each offers such a variety of subtleties and idiosyncrasies that the potential for unique strategies abounds.
A wealth of units and buildings inside Starcraft 2and the way each card changes the possibilities gives players a huge amount of freedom in how they play. Whether it's an economical long game or a fast pace, there are many angles to every match.

Adapted from the board game of the same name, Dune: Empire it's naturally a mechanically dense experience. Combining worker placement structure with classic deck building gameplay, Dune: Empire offers a diverse set of strategies on several levels.
While players may be limited and forced to adapt to the decisions of other players, there is still a huge amount of freedom when it comes to playstyle. This is due in part to the variety of leaders players can choose from, each offering their own unique strengths and weaknesses. In addition, card variety and well-balanced board positions ensure that there are almost always multiple options.

Dune: Spice Wars is a fully themed mix of 4X and RTS games set in the iconic Frank Herbert universe Dune. The game emphasizes base building and resource management and often encourages patience, tactical awareness, and risky gambits.
With a diverse research tree and incredible asymmetric faction design, every game Dune: Spice Wars can play in different ways. This is further enhanced by the game's variety of win conditions, allowing players to focus on everything from economics and war to politics and espionage.
